1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a method over the internet wherein a lengthy URL is often transformed right into a shorter, a lot more manageable form. This shortened URL redirects to the original prolonged URL when visited. Providers like Bitly and TinyURL are well-identified examples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the advent of social networking platforms like Twitter, the place character limits for posts designed it hard to share lengthy URLs.

Over and above social media, URL shorteners are useful in advertising and marketing strategies, e-mails, and printed media in which very long URLs may be cumbersome.

2. Core Elements of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ener usually consists of the next components:

Net Interface: This can be the front-conclusion section the place customers can enter their extensive URLs and receive shortened versions. It might be a simple type over a Online page.
Databases: A database is important to shop the mapping in between the original extended URL along with the shortened Model.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L choices like MongoDB can be used.
Redirection Logic: This is the backend logic that normally takes the quick URL and redirects the consumer towards the corresponding extended URL. This logic is often executed in the net server or an software layer.
API: Many URL shorteners give an API so that third-social gathering apps can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the initial lengthy URLs.
three. Developing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a protracted URL into a brief one particular. Quite a few techniques is usually used, such as:

Hashing: The extensive URL may be hashed into a set-size string, which serves since the limited URL. Having said that, hash collisions (diverse URLs resulting in the identical hash) have to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: A single widespread approach is to work with Base62 encoding (which makes use of sixty two characters: 0-nine, A-Z, along with a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to your entry in the database. This technique makes sure that the brief URL is as shorter as you possibly can.
Random String Generation: A different tactic is always to deliver a random string of a hard and fast length (e.g., six people) and Look at if it’s already in use inside the databases. If not, it’s assigned to the prolonged URL.
4. Database Administration
The databases schema for just a URL shortener is generally straightforward, with two Major fields:

ID: A novel identifier for each URL entry.
Extensive URL: The initial URL that should be shortened.
Short URL/Slug: The limited Variation from the URL, typically saved as a unique string.
As well as these, you should retailer metadata like the generation day, expiration date, and the amount of periods the shorter URL continues to be accessed.

five. Managing Redirection
Redirection is a critical Portion of the URL shortener's operation. Each time a consumer clicks on a brief URL, the services ought to speedily retrieve the first URL from your database and redirect the person employing an HTTP 301 (long term redirect) or 302 (non permanent redirect) status code.

Efficiency is vital right here, as the procedure ought to be approximately instantaneous. Strategies like databases indexing and caching (e.g., utilizing Redis or Memcached) is often employed to speed up the retrieval system.

six. Protection Issues
Stability is a major issue in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ener might be abused to distribute malicious back links. Employing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-party protection expert services to check URLs before shortening them can mitigate this possibility.
Spam Avoidance: Price limiting and CAPTCHA can protect against abuse by spammers attempting to make Many short URLs.
7. Scalability
Since the URL shortener grows, it might require to take care of countless URLs and redirect requests. This requires a scalable architecture, perhaps invol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ute targeted visitors throughout various servers to take care of superior hundreds.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ases which can sc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Different fears like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inctive companies to boost sc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ners usually offer analytics to track how frequently a brief URL is clicked, the place the targeted visitors is coming from, and other useful metrics. This calls for logging Every red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.
